Abstract
The invention discloses a kind of new mechanical and electrical equipments with heat radiation protection function; including plant bottom case; gear circular groove is opened up at the top of the plant bottom case; fixed block is fixedly connected among the gear circular groove; the fixed block top center is equipped with motor; support plate is fixedly connected at the top of the motor; fixed plate is connected with by support rod at the top of the support plate; fixed link is welded at left and right sides of the fixed plate; the quantity of the fixed link is two groups, and the bottom of fixed has been respectively fixedly connected with the first mixing cabinet and the second mixing cabinet.The present invention passes through equipped with the gear circular groove on the gear and plant bottom case on swingle, it can use motor and drive the first mixing tank and the rotation of the second mixing tank, rotate the first mixing tank and the second mixing tank not only itself can, and by the drive of gear, swingle can be made also to be rotated, it is more practical to hybrid pigment into mixing, it is suitble to be widely popularized and uses.

When a kind of new mechanical and electrical equipment with heat radiation protection function uses, first working power 23 is powered,
After working power 23 is powered, material is poured into from the feed inlet 18 on the first mixing cabinet 16 and the second mixing cabinet 17, then
Water is added, then by between the partition 37 of hot-forming decorative panel insertion heat radiation box 9, then opens the first control switch 24
Start motor 2, motor 2 drives motor shaft 3, and motor shaft 3 drives support plate 4, and support plate 4 drives support rod 5, and support rod 5 drives
Fixed plate 6, fixed plate 6 drive fixed link 15, first to mix cabinet 16 and the second mixing cabinet 17, the first mixing cabinet 16 and the
Two mixing cabinets 17 will drive the movement of gear 30, and mobile gear 30 can rotate on gear circular groove 28, and gear 30 will drive rotation
Bull stick 20 rotates, and swingle 20 will drive the first mixed pole 32 and the second mixed pole 33, material be mixed, in fixation
While plate rotates, it will drive bearing 7 and rotated around connecting rod 8, the bearing 7 of rotation will drive blowing fan blade 14 and blow upwards
Wind, wind-force can carry out heat radiation protection to the decorative panel in heat radiation box 9 by the first air-permeating hole 34 and the second air-permeating hole 35, dissipate
The 4th control switch 27 starting semiconductor chilling plate 13 can also be opened in the process of heat, to the decorative panel inside heat radiation box 9
It further radiates, can star the second control switch 25 and third control switch 26 after the completion of material mixing, open
First solenoid valve 22 and second solenoid valve 31 release material, due to being arranged on the first mixing cabinet 16 and the second mixing cabinet 17
There is spring 38, shaking force when the first mixing cabinet 16 and the second mixing mixing of cabinet 17 can be effectively reduced, it should be noted that
If controlling the temperature of semiconductor chilling plate 13, temperature controller can be installed in equipment.
